British distributors 88 Films have detailed their upcoming Blu-ray release of Jackie Chan's film The Young Master (1980). The two-disc set will be available for purchase on January 25.

Description: Jackie Chan was already a star when he made The Young Master but this film took him to another level. He plays 'Dragon' who undertakes a mission to find his missing brother, and gets into plenty of scrapes along the way - not least being mistaken for a criminal that the authorities are very keen to put behind bars...

The Young Master was Jackie's second film as director, and he used it as a showcase to demonstrate just what he could do. And it remains a firm favorite of the fans, featuring some of the best set-pieces he ever cooked up. The black-belts at 88 Films are thrilled to present the UK Blu-ray premier of this true Hong Kong classic.

DISC TWO
  • INTERNATIONAL EXPORT CUT (90 MIN) - Restored especially for the 40th Anniversary of the film, this version was commissioned by Golden Harvest for audiences outside Asia. Contains the Classic English Dub and an alternate soundtrack featuring the song 'Kung Fu Fighting Man' performed in English by Jackie Chan
  • Audio Commentary with HK cinema aficionados & game producers Audi Sorlie & Chris Ling

  • EXTENDED EXPORT CUT (99 MIN) - Released exclusively in Japan on 21st March 1981 by Toho-Towa, this version is broadly similar to the export cut. Although shorter than the Hong Kong cut, this composite cut features the uncut final fight and ending from said Hong Kong cut; alternate scenes, also included in the 90 minute export cut and the full-length export English Dub with alternate soundtrack
